Eric Valosin
Aletheia Study VII
2012
Charcoal Erasure and Graphite on Paper
24x18
The seventh in a series of drawing Studies attempting to extract some drawing techniques from an intersection of Plato and Heidegger's views on truth. Here interaction of the two philosophies is drawn out to its most ambiguous point, with each creating and revealing the other in counterintuitive ways. The stained glass window through which the revealing shadow shines, is a variation on Raphael's Plato in the Temple
